The Delhi High Court SPA & PA Recruitment 2026 is a major opportunity for graduates looking for a government job in the judicial sector. The High Court of Delhi has released a vacancy notice for Senior Personal Assistant (SPA) and Personal Assistant (PA) posts, with a total of 150 vacancies.
According to the official vacancy notice, eligible candidates can submit their applications online from 15 September 2026 to 5 October 2026. The recruitment is aimed at candidates who possess a bachelor’s degree along with the required English shorthand and computer typing skills.
The recruitment includes 117 Senior Personal Assistant vacancies and 33 Personal Assistant vacancies. Both are Group ‘B’ positions under the Delhi High Court, with the SPA post placed at Pay Level 8 and the PA post at Pay Level 7 of the 7th CPC Pay Matrix.

Delhi High Court SPA & PA Eligibility Criteria 2026
Candidates should make sure they satisfy both the educational qualification and skill requirements before applying.
Educational Qualification
Applicants must possess a Bachelor’s degree from a recognised university or equivalent institution.
In addition to graduation, candidates must have the required computer knowledge and English shorthand/typing skills prescribed for the respective post.
Therefore, simply having a graduation degree is not sufficient for these positions. Candidates should also be comfortable with English stenography and computer typing.
Shorthand and Typing Requirements
The shorthand requirement is one of the most important parts of the recruitment.
For Senior Personal Assistant
Candidates applying for the SPA position need:
- English shorthand speed: 110 words per minute
- English typing speed: 40 words per minute
- Required computer knowledge
For Personal Assistant
Candidates applying for the PA position need:
- English shorthand speed: 100 words per minute
- English typing speed: 40 words per minute
- Required computer knowledge
The different shorthand requirements mean candidates should select their preferred post carefully and prepare according to the applicable speed requirement.
Delhi High Court SPA PA Age Limit 2026
The prescribed age limit is 18 to 32 years.
The age is calculated as of 1 January 2026. Candidates belonging to eligible reserved categories may receive age relaxation according to the applicable government and recruitment rules.
Applicants should verify their date of birth and category eligibility from the official notice before submitting the form.
Delhi High Court SPA & PA Salary 2026
One of the biggest attractions of this recruitment is the 7th CPC pay structure.
Senior Personal Assistant Salary
The Senior Personal Assistant post is placed at Pay Level 8.
Pay Scale: ₹47,600 – ₹1,51,100
Personal Assistant Salary
The Personal Assistant post is placed at Pay Level 7.
Pay Scale: ₹44,900 – ₹1,42,400
These are pay-matrix figures. The actual monthly salary received by an employee can vary depending on applicable allowances, deductions and government rules.

Delhi High Court SPA PA Application Fee
Candidates are required to pay the prescribed online application fee.
Fee Structure
- General / OBC-NCL / EWS: ₹1,500
- SC / ST / specified PwBD categories: ₹1,300
Applicable payment or transaction charges may be additional.
Candidates should complete the payment within the application deadline. An application without the required fee, where applicable, may not be considered complete.
Delhi High Court SPA & PA Selection Process 2026
The selection process is designed to test candidates’ typing, stenography, written communication and overall suitability for the post.
The recruitment process includes the following major stages:
1. English Typing Test
Candidates will have to demonstrate the prescribed English typing speed on a computer.
For both SPA and PA positions, the required typing speed is 40 WPM.
2. English Shorthand Test
This is particularly important because the two posts have different shorthand requirements.
- SPA: 110 WPM
- PA: 100 WPM
Candidates preparing for the examination should practise shorthand regularly under timed conditions.
3. Main Descriptive Examination
Candidates who qualify the applicable skill tests will proceed to the main written examination.
The descriptive examination evaluates candidates’ written English and related abilities according to the recruitment scheme.
4. Interview
Shortlisted candidates will be called for the interview stage as prescribed under the recruitment process.
